    Sensei, from Australia, thank for sharing your knowledge, skill and wisdom! The information regarding the key essences of each waza is priceless. I like techniques like this as they are suitable for smaller people against larger opponents especially is self defense. At our jujutsu school we still practice the majority of the kodokan nage waza with various entries although variations. After all, judo is a life long endeavor! One of the entries I like for this technique is to create the kuzushi by attacking the hip with a firm push while simultaneously drawing the leg. As I am outside of say the right leg, left hand attacks/pushes diagonally down on the top of the hip to make uki sit past their heels. Thank you again.

    Domo arigatou for featuring this waza. Kibisu-gaeshi is one of those ingenious and sly throws that are eminently practical and perfect for those who do not possess a great deal of physical strength. Sadly it is nearly forgotten because of the IJF prohibition against techniques involving leg grabs. Riki-sensei took the words right out of my mouth: it IS a foolish rule.
